Kingwood Golf Club & Resort
About
Kingwood Golf Club in Clayton is nestled in the foothills of the Blue Ridge Mountains, surrounded by nearly 150,000 acres of protected national forest. While playing the course, it's likely you'll hear the roar of the nearby Chattooga River. The course is considered one of Georgia's best, thanks in large part to the stunning location, which lends mature hardwoods, rippling brooks, and lush green hills. The visually stunning golf course can seem intimidating, but four sets of tees guarantee that players of all skill levels can enjoy playing it. The par-71 layout measures just over 6,000 yards, a demanding length given the small greens and tight landing areas. A variety of elevation changes and strategically placed bunkers will test your accuracy at Kingwood G.C. Tee shot placement will also be an important factor in your score.

Fun mountain golf
Kingwood is a short, mountain style golf course. I played it from the back tees and hit driver 6 times. The course is in great shape, with firm greens that roll well. My favorite hole is #13; a beautiful flat hole along a meandering creek. However, #17 may be one of the worst golf holes ever designed, with almost no landing area for the tee shot and a green that is stuck behind a hill. It looks like they built 17 other holes and realized they had to stick one more somewhere. Other than that, it's fun, well conditioned, and you can get around pretty quick. A little pricey at $61.
